| <td valign="top">[[Image:Forge.png|left]]'''[[Forge]]''' came to [[Xavier's School for Gifted Youngsters]] following an attempt to blow up his high school in response to prolonged bullying left him with an artificial leg and hand. He quickly found himself a 'tribe' at the school, identifying himself as a mutant before anything else and using his power of instinctive mechanical hypercognition - or the ability to create any device he understood the working of - to assist his classmates and the [[X-Men]] on many occasions. His sympathy for [[Magneto]] ended following [[With Malice Aforethought| an abduction]] and the forced creation of the [[Neutralizer]] and after his [[Sound of Silence| time marooned in another dimension]] which aged him two and a half years more than his peers, he joined the team and became the security specialist to the mansion. | In [[September 2009]] Forge joined [[Scott Summers]] and [[Jean Grey]] in relocating to the [[West Coast Annex]] in order to assist in forming a base of operations for a new X-Men team based on the west coast. As a result of him throwing himself completely into his work, his relationship with Crystal suffered and in [[January 2010]] they agreed to end it.
